Parenting Guide Example
My parenting guide example is quiet simple, my dreams for my children are
for them grow up in a loving family,
For every member of my family to develop a high level of emotional intelligence.
For our children to grow up to be responsible, compassionate and independent adults who still enjoy spending time with us
Now this in itself is not going to give much in the way of guidance, it is too general. So my next step is to be more specific about what each of the above mean to me and to my partner.
For my children to grow up in a loving family
For the family unit to respect each other and express their feelings in positive ways (no putting each other down when angry or upset)
For the family unit to enjoy spending time together
For the parents to be great role models for what a happy and for filled marriage should be.
For the family to be able to communicate with each other in effective ways, where disagreements could be resolved through give and take with a win-win result.
Why
A loving family environment would help to promote self confidence in all members and give each member a solid support base for life. This environment would give us all the physical and emotional security required by individuals to function properly as describe in Maslow’s hierarchy of needs
For every member of my family to develop a high level of emotional intelligence
Emotional intelligence refers to how well some one is able to understand their own feelings, those of others and also how well they interact with other people.
In a nut shell this is exactly what I have been studying and learning about for the past 20 years so as you can probably guess it is extremely important for my family to achieve a high level of emotional intelligence.
